Portrait mode isn’t just for photos. With BOCA, you can shoot videos with a beautiful depth-of-field blur effect. Depth-of-field is the videographer’s term for a blurred background that leaves the subject looking crisp and sharp. Tweak the blur effect just the way you want by dragging the slider — add more or less blur to get just the right look. Your videos will end up looking amazing! BOCA simulates the effect of a photographer’s lens by using depth information from the iPhone’s TrueDepth or dual cameras. Check the compatibility list below to ensure BOCA works with your device. Features: - Drag the slider to change the amount of blur — before or after recording a video. - Tap the viewfinder to set focus and exposure. - Use the volume button as a “shutter”. Just press the volume button to start or stop recording. - Play and edit your recorded videos on the review screen - Save edited videos to your camera roll, or share them with other apps - Search through previously recorded videos from the explorer screen, or select a video for playback and editing Compatibility: BOCA requires a compatible device: Recording from both cameras is supported on iPhone X, iPhone XS and iPhone XS Max. The iPhone XR only supports the camera on the front of the phone (the selfie camera). The iPhone 7 Plus and iPhone 8 Plus only support the camera on the back of the phone. The iPhone 7, iPhone 7 Plus and iPhone 8 do not have compatible cameras.
